if you’re going out early in the week (Sun-Wed), be aware that less people will be out the later it gets. but on weekends people will be out really late, especially around bars and in the neighborhoods you’d be going to
some notes/tips - you could always look at the specific bar locations and go to one that‘s under a few minutes’ walk to a subway stop. i also would strongly not recommend getting trashed if you‘re new to the subway so you can have a clear head navigating — and be sure you know the difference between “express” and “local”. also citymapper > google/apple maps
but really the #1 thing is just to mind your business - don’t stare, keep your bag on your lap, and just read/look at your phone/listen to music. i usually wear (wired) earbuds on a lower volume when walking and on the subway so i can hear things but it’s obvious i don’t want to chat ! and in the rare instance someone is making you nervous or just being really annoying, at the next stop you can just switch to a different car on the train
